Paladin Equity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Paladin Equity in the United States is $100,681.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$48. Salaries at Paladin Equity typically range from $88,318 to $114,086 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Los Angeles?

Understanding the cost of living near Los Angeles is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Paladin Equity.
Los Angeles' Cost of Living Index is approximately 173.3 (73.3% more expensive than US average; 23.9% more than CA average). Driven by extremely expensive housing, high transportation costs, and above-average goods/services. When planning your budget based on a salary from Paladin Equity,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,500 - $3,800+ A significant portion of Paladin Equity sal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$100 (Metro TAP card varies)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$700 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$500 - $1,000+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$4,050 - $6,450+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
